4 include $(TOP
)/configs
/current
7 INCLUDE_DIRS
= -I
$(TOP
)/include
9 HEADERS
= $(TOP
)/include/GLES
/egl.h
25 $(CC
) -c
$(INCLUDE_DIRS
) $(CFLAGS
) $< -o
$@
32 demo1
: demo1.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
33 $(CC
) $(CFLAGS
) $(LDFLAGS
) demo1.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
$(LIBDRM_LIB
) -o
$@
35 demo1.o
: demo1.c
$(HEADERS
)
36 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include demo1.c
39 demo2
: demo2.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
40 $(CC
) $(CFLAGS
) $(LDFLAGS
) demo2.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) $(APP_LIB_DEPS
) -o
$@
42 demo2.o
: demo2.c
$(HEADERS
)
43 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include demo2.c
46 demo3
: demo3.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
47 $(CC
) $(CFLAGS
) $(LDFLAGS
) demo3.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) $(APP_LIB_DEPS
) -o
$@
49 demo3.o
: demo3.c
$(HEADERS
)
50 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include demo3.c
53 egltri
: egltri.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
54 $(CC
) $(CFLAGS
) egltri.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) -o
$@
56 egltri.o
: egltri.c
$(HEADERS
)
57 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include egltri.c
60 eglinfo
: eglinfo.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
61 $(CC
) $(CFLAGS
) $(LDFLAGS
) eglinfo.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) -o
$@
63 eglinfo.o
: eglinfo.c
$(HEADERS
)
64 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include eglinfo.c
67 eglgears
: eglgears.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
68 $(CC
) $(CFLAGS
) $(LDFLAGS
) eglgears.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) $(APP_LIB_DEPS
) -o
$@
70 eglgears.o
: eglgears.c
$(HEADERS
)
71 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include eglgears.c
73 eglscreen
: eglscreen.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
74 $(CC
) $(CFLAGS
) $(LDFLAGS
) eglscreen.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) $(APP_LIB_DEPS
) -o
$@
76 eglscreen.o
: eglscreen.c
$(HEADERS
)
77 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include eglscreen.c
79 peglgears
: peglgears.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
80 $(CC
) $(CFLAGS
) peglgears.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) $(APP_LIB_DEPS
) -o
$@
82 peglgears.o
: peglgears.c
$(HEADERS
)
83 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include peglgears.c
86 xeglgears
: xeglgears.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
87 $(CC
) $(CFLAGS
) xeglgears.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) $(APP_LIB_DEPS
) -o
$@
89 xeglgears.o
: xeglgears.c
$(HEADERS
)
90 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include xeglgears.c
93 xegl_tri
: xegl_tri.o
$(TOP
)/$(LIB_DIR
)/libEGL.so
94 $(CC
) $(CFLAGS
) xegl_tri.o
-L
$(TOP
)/$(LIB_DIR
) -lEGL
-lGL
$(LIBDRM_LIB
) $(APP_LIB_DEPS
) -o
$@
96 xegl_tri.o
: xegl_tri.c
$(HEADERS
)
97 $(CC
) -c
$(CFLAGS
) -I
$(TOP
)/include xegl_tri.c